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server 培训
本课程的目的是清楚地了解 Microsoft SQL Server 的 (SQL) 的高级使用以及 Transact-SQL 的高级使用。如需更深入地了解主题,本课程可以作为为期三天的课程进行。
课程大纲
结构化查询语言综述
- DQL、DML、DDL
- GROUP BY, HAVING 子句
- 子查询和相关子查询
- 高级更新和删除语句
- 子查询
- 相关子查询
程序 Programming
- 变量
- Control-of-Flow 语句
- IF、WHILE、CASE、GOTO、RETURN
管理错误
- 响应错误
- RAISERROR的
- 打印
使用事务
- 交易简介
- 事务隔离级别
- 僵局
- 事务性错误处理
实现游标
- 声明游标
- 打开、获取、关闭
- 解除分配
- 电流
存储过程
- 创建存储过程
- 将值传递到存储过程中
- 从存储过程返回信息
- 更改存储过程
触发器
- 创建触发器
- 事务性错误处理
- 使用插入的表和已删除的表
要求
代表应熟悉 Microsoft SQL 服务器 SQL 语言
需要帮助选择合适的课程吗?
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server 培训 - Enquiry
客户评论 (7)
Lot of content and exactly the requested one.
Pascal - Diehl
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
There were a lot of exercises really good exercises and the trainer passed on his knowledge well.
Zsolt - Diehl
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
Communicative, big knowledge and well presented material
Filip Gotowicki - EY GDS (CS) POLAND SP. Z O.O.
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
Open, frank and knowledgeable
Shiva Wagle - Mosaic Primary Care Network
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
It is interactive
Syed Muhammad Mehdi - Mosaic Primary Care Network
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
The content of the training
Kyvin Aw - Asure Quality LTD
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
The range of topics and challenging challenges
Darroch Ward - Asure Quality LTD
课程 - Advanced SQL, Stored Procedures and Triggers for Microsoft SQL Server
即将举行的公开课程
相关课程
Administering in Microsoft SQL Server
21 小时该课程专为管理员、开发人员和资料库开发人员设计。
培训目标:
- 获得并加强创建和管理资料库的技能
- 了解语法并使用 SQL 检索和修改数据
- 在资料库中应用安全规则
- 使用进阶元素(复制、自动化、BI)
- 使用 Microsoft SQL Server 功能为开发人员创建复杂的报告和解决方案
Business Intelligence in MS SQL Server 2008
14 小时培训专门讲授基于 MS SQL Server 2008 创建数据仓库环境的基础知识。
课程参与者将获得设计和构建在 MS SQL Server 2008 上运行的数据仓库的基础。
了解如何基于 SSIS 构建简单的 ETL 过程,然后使用 SSAS 设计和实现数据立方体。
参与者将能够管理 OLAP 数据库:在线创建和删除数据库 OLAP 处理分区更改。
参与者将获得脚本 XML / A 和 MDX 的知识。
Microsoft SQL Server (MSSQL)
14 小时本课程是为已经熟悉 Microsoft SQL Server Environment 2008/2012 中 SQL 的代表创建的。本课程侧重于基于集合的查询和查询调优、使用索引和分析执行计划。
培训还涵盖表表达式、排名函数以及如何处理分区表。
Introduction to SQL Server 2012 Integration Services (SSIS)
28 小时此讲师指导的现场培训<本地>(在线或现场)面向希望熟练掌握 SQL Server 2012 Integration Services 的初级到中级开发人员和资料库管理员。
在本次培训结束时,参与者将能够:
- 了解 ETL 的原理和 SSIS 的作用。
- 创建、部署和管理 SSIS 包。
- 设计并实现Control Flow 以定义包中的任务流。
- 实施 Workflow 并设置约束条件以有效执行任务。
- 构建数据流以提取、转换和载入数据。
- 使用 Variables 和 Container 来增强包的灵活性。
- 管理 Transactions 以确保数据一致性。
- 实施有效的错误处理和调试技术。
- 设置Logging以进行跟踪和监控。
- Handle Slowly Changing Dimensions 用于管理不断变化的数据。
- 部署包以供生产使用。
- 实施安全措施以保护敏感数据。
- 利用脚本来扩展 SSIS 功能。
- 应用最佳实践以获得高效且可维护的 SSIS 解决方案。
Developing Desktop Applications with Visual Studio 2012, VB.NET and SQL Server 2012
21 小时本课程分为 3 个主要部分,由演讲和实践练习混合组成。
- VB.NET 2012年Visual Studio的语言
- VB.NET 对象方向
- VB.NET 和 Sql Server 2012
MS SQL Server 2019
14 小时这种以讲师为主导的中国现场现场培训面向希望学习如何配置和管理数据库数据工作负载的高级数据库管理员。
在培训结束时,参与者将能够:
- 创建和管理数据库、表和查询。
- 管理查询性能。
- 创建和还原数据库备份。
Administration with Powershell
35 小时此强化培训提供使用 Windows PowerShell 自动管理基于 Windows 的电脑的基本知识和技能。 本课程中教授的技能适用于所有使用 Windows PowerShell 进行日常管理的所有 Microsoft 产品。
培训主要侧重于将 Windows PowerShell 用作互动式命令行介面,但它也包括对脚本和程式设计主题的一些介绍。
T-SQL Fundamentals with SQL Server Training Course
14 小时这个 SQL 培训课程是为那些想要获得处理 SQL 服务器 Database 的基本技能的人准备的。课程将帮助成员学习:
- 如何使用 SQL 服务器和 SQL 服务器 Management Studio。
- Databases、SQL 和 RDBMS 等的含义
- 如何创建表,使用 DDL、DML 和 DAL。
- 哪些是市场上的各种RDBMS软件包,以及它们如何相互比较。
- 简介 NoSQL 以及它们如何组织正在转变为混合数据库。
Learning SQL with Microsoft SQL Server
21 小时Microsoft SQL Server 是一个用于存储和检索数据的关系资料库管理系统 (RDBMS)。
在这个讲师指导的现场培训(现场或远端)中,参与者将学习查询 Microsoft SQL Server 资料库所需的 SQL 语言的基本知识。
在本次培训结束时,参与者将能够:
- 安装和配置 Microsoft SQL 伺服器
- 使用 Microsoft 的 Transact-SQL (T-SQL) 语言查询 Microsoft SQL Server 资料库
- 了解资料库设计的要点
- 通过规范化优化资料库
- 使用聚合函数生成类似于 “pivot-tables” 的结果
- Access Microsoft SQL 伺服器通过 Excel
观众
- 数据分析师
- Business 情报专业人员
- Business 经理
- Excel 希望扩展其分析技能的专家
课程形式
- 互动讲座和讨论
- 大量的练习和练习
- 在即时实验室环境中动手实施
课程自定义选项
- 本培训基于最新版本的 Microsoft SQL 伺服器
- 要申请本课程的定制培训,请联系我们进行安排。
SQL Server Management Studio (SSMS) Administration
21 小时这种以讲师为主导的中国现场培训(现场或远程)面向中级数据库管理员,他们希望学习必要的技能和知识,以使用SQL Server Management Studio有效地管理和管理SQL服务器数据库。
在培训结束时,参与者将能够:
- 了解系统要求并执行安装。
- 使用 SSMS 创建、配置和管理数据库。
- 管理登录名、用户、角色和权限。
- 执行各种类型的备份和还原数据库。
- 使用 SQL Server Agent 创建、计划和管理作业。
- 实施高效、安全的 SQL 服务器管理最佳实践。
Business Intelligence with SSAS
14 小时SSAS (SQL Server Analysis Services) 是一个 Microsoft SQL 伺服器事务处理 (OLAP) 和数据挖掘工具,用于分析多个资料库、表或文件中的数据。SSAS 提供的语义数据模型被 Power BI、Excel、Reporting Services 和其他数据可视化工具等用户端应用程式使用。
在这个由讲师指导的现场培训(现场或远端)中,参与者将学习如何使用 SSAS 分析资料库和数据仓库中的大量数据。
在本次培训结束时,参与者将能够:
- 安装和配置 SSAS
- 了解 SSAS、SSIS 和 SSRS 之间的关系
- 应用多维数据建模从数据中提取业务洞察
- 设计 OLAP (Online Analytical Processing) 多维数据集
- 使用 MDX (Multidimensional Expressions) 查询语言查询和操作多维数据
- 使用 SSAS 部署实际的 BI 解决方案
观众
- BI (Business 智慧) 专业人员
- 数据分析师
- Database 和数据仓库专业人员
课程形式
- 互动讲座和讨论
- 大量的练习和练习
- 在即时实验室环境中动手实施
课程自定义选项
- 本培训基于最新版本的 Microsoft SQL Server 和 SSAS。
- 要申请本课程的定制培训,请联系我们进行安排。
Introduction to SQL Server 2022 Integration Services (SSIS)
28 小时这种以讲师为主导的 中国(在线或现场)实时培训面向希望学习如何设计、实现和管理 SSIS 包以执行数据集成和转换任务的初级数据专业人员。
在培训结束时,参与者将能够:
- 了解 SSIS 的体系结构和组件。
- 使用 SSIS 设计和实现 ETL 流程。
- 使用 SSIS 工具开发、部署和管理数据集成解决方案。
- 排除故障并优化 SSIS 软件包的性能和可靠性。